BIO

BROADWAY: Mamma Mia!, West Side Story (Indio, Chino u/s) NAT'L TOURS: West Side Story (swing), We Will Rock You (Brit u/s) REGIONAL: MUNY, Westchester Altar Boyz (Juan), Cathy Rigby's Peter Pan, Orchid: A Burlesque Circus (lead vocalist) TV: One Life To Live. BFA, Cal. State-Fullerton. Thanks to Bloc Agency, Mom, Felicia, Phil, and Tio Mike's Milanese at El Jardin Restaurant in Chicago.

Interview: Landen Gonzales and Brady Fritz Portray the Two-Sides of an AMERICAN IDIOT
by Gil Kaan - Oct 13, 2024

The Mark Taper Forum re-opened with Green Day’s rock opera American Idiot October 9, 2024 (with previews beginning October 2nd). CTG Artistic Director Snehal Desai will be making his CTG directorial debut working with Deaf West Artistic Director DJ Kurs directing an ensemble of both Deaf and hearing actors, performing simultaneously in American Sign Language and Spoken English. The large cast includes: Steven-Adam Agdeppa, Will Branner, Jerusha Cavazos, Lark Detweiler, Daniel Durant, Kaia T. Fitzgerald, Brady Fritz, Landen Gonzales, Otis Jones IV, Milo Manheim, Josué Martinez, Giovanni Maucere, James Olivas, Patrick Ortiz, Mason Alexander Park, Monika Peña, Mars Storm Rucker, Mia Sempertegui, Angel Theory and Ali Fumiko Whitney. Review: BOTTLESHOCK! THE MUSICAL at CCAE Theatricals
by ErinMarie Reiter - Jul 12, 2023

BOTTLESHOCK! THE MUSICAL at CCAE Theatricals brings the beauty of Napa Valley and the tale of the underdog 1970s winery that took Paris and the world of wine by storm in the summer of 1976. This original musical has some beautifully sung numbers, an abundance of heart, and also some wine-tasting options if you really want to feel immersive.  BOTTLESHOCK! THE MUSICAL is running through July 23rd at California Center for the Arts in Escondido.
